Director, Business Operations Management

Your role at Dynatrace

The Director, D1 Operations (AMER) is a senior leader responsible for operating and scaling a high-impact post-sales operations function supporting the Insights and OnDemand organization. This role owns the operating model, translates strategy into execution, and ensures post-sales teams operate with speed, consistency, governance, and measurable outcomes.

As a member of the extended D1 Operations leadership team, you will lead a team of analysts and partner closely with the Insights and OnDemand leadership team to align global strategy and priorities. You will balance strategic ownership with select hands-on engagement on the highest-impact initiatives. This role requires deep post-sales operations expertise, strong cross-functional partnership, and a vision for applying automation and AI to reduce operational friction while scaling delivery excellence globally.

Key Responsibilities
  • Serve as the primary operational partner to post-sales Insights and OnDemand leadership, shaping and implementing global alignment of standards and priorities
  • Lead, develop, and scale the regional D1 Operations team
  • Partner with D1 Operations peers and D1 leadership to set clear priorities and ensure consistent execution against roadmap deliverables
  • Operate as a hands-on leader, personally own high-impact initiatives while demonstrating operational excellence to the team
  • Establish and maintain a strong operating rhythm for the organization, including oversight of programs, reporting, workflows, and documentation
  • Partner with business leaders and team members to continually identify bottlenecks and translate them into clear problem statements and proposed solutions
  • Identify repetitive, high-volume manual work performed by delivery teams and implement automation to eliminate it
  • Apply AI-enabled approaches to improve throughput, governance, and data quality

About Dynatrace

Dynatrace is a software company that provides application performance management software to businesses. The company's software helps businesses monitor and optimize the performance of their applications, ensuring that they are running smoothly and efficiently. Dynatrace was founded in 2005 and is headquartered in Waltham, Massachusetts. The company has over 2,500 employees and serves customers in over 70 countries.
